Abstract

Solar energy collection device that includes a panel provided with a plurality of ducts and means for moving a fluid to and from the ducts, characterized in that. It includes two relatively flat elements (4) that are separated by internal wall elements (6) these elements forming ducts that allow the uniform circulation of the fluid through them, because the elements of the panel and the internal wall elements are constituted in a single piece of plastic material or crushed glass and in that the means that ensure the flow of the fluid to and from the conduits each include a manifold that extends along opposite edges of the panels and communicates with each conduit.
